Brian Blessed: The Mighty Voice Behind Vultan in Flash Gordon (1980)

The iconic, booming voice and physically imposing presence that embodied Prince Vultan, leader of the Hawkmen in the 1980 film Flash Gordon, belonged to none other than the celebrated British actor, Brian Blessed. Blessed’s portrayal of the boisterous, larger-than-life Vultan cemented the character’s place in cinematic history, becoming one of the most memorable aspects of the campy, yet beloved, space opera.

From Stage to Screen: Blessed’s Early Career

Blessed’s acting career began on the stage, where he honed his skills in classical and contemporary productions. He studied at the Bristol Old Vic Theatre School and quickly gained recognition for his talent. This theatrical background provided him with the essential tools to deliver Vultan’s over-the-top pronouncements with conviction and authenticity. Before Flash Gordon, Blessed also appeared in prominent television series such as Z-Cars and I, Claudius, proving his versatility.

The Queen Soundtrack: An Iconic Score

Queen’s soundtrack for Flash Gordon is arguably one of the most iconic in film history. The bombastic music perfectly complements the film’s operatic tone, adding to its sense of grandeur and adventure. The soundtrack’s popularity has further cemented the film’s place in popular culture.

FAQ 1: What other notable roles has Brian Blessed played?

Beyond Vultan, Brian Blessed has enjoyed a diverse and prolific acting career. He’s been celebrated for his roles in Henry V, Blackadder, Star Wars: Episode I – The Phantom Menace, and many stage productions. His versatility is one of his greatest strengths.
